Mamma Mia! The Movie fans already have Skopelos on their vacations plans but you really don’t need a reason to visit this beautiful island. There are 360 churches and chapels to visit and there are also lovely beaches to check out, including Kastani Beach where some movie scenes were shot.

The only way to get to Skopelos is by ferry but there are plenty of connections, including from the other Sporades (Alonissos, Skiathos, Peristera and Skyros) as well as Volos and Thessaloniki.

Skopelos or Glossa ?

Both! Actually Loutraki is the port of Glossa and where your ferry will arrive but don’t expect to find Loutraki on the ticket. On line booking sites and for the ferry operators, the port is called Glossa , just like the village above. Glossa is located on the northwestern side of the island.

Skopelos is the capital and main port on the island of Skopelos. It is located on the southern side of the island.

How long does it take to get from Alonissos to Skopelos?

The journey between Alonissos and Skopelos takes 20 minutes (or 30 min in some cases). The journey to Glossa takes between 1h and 1h 30 min.

How much does it cost to get from Alonissos to Skopelos by ferry?

The ticket prices always depend on the ferry company, type of ferry and the class you are purchasing tickets for.

On a ferry (30 min) operated by Blue Star Ferries, on the Alonissos to Skopelos Port, the economy ticket is €6 / one way / 1 adult.

On a ferry to Glossa, the economy ticket is €9 / one way / 1 adult.

Where can I buy tickets from?

Ideally you should buy the ticket either from a travel agency or from the port but the tickets can be bought online as well. However, restrictions apply when you buy them online (you cannot purchases tickets for months ahead).

Does everyone charge the same prices?

No matter where you buy the tickets from, the prices are the same.

Important note:

It is a good idea to double check the schedule couple of days before departure. The ferry companies submit their schedule every Friday to the Ministry of Mercantile Marine which means there might be slight differences from week to week, let along from month to month.
